Default values (defaults)

Description

This lets you set the default values for certain list and multiple choice question types.

Starting in version 1.92, you can also set default values for text-entry questions.

Valid values

  • For multiple choice questions, you will see drop-down boxes letting you select the desired default
  • For text-entry questions, you will have a text entry field in which you can enter any string or expression. If you use an expression, you need to include curly braces

Example

  • You have a non-anonymous survey, where {TOKEN:ATTRIBUTE_1} is the person's age as of the time the tokens table was created. You want to prefill a question with the person's age and ask them to validate that the age is accurate, or let them change the age value if it is not accurate. In the text entry field for the default value, you would enter {TOKEN:ATTRIBUTE_1}
